What is confiscation?

This is a special procedure, detailed in the legislation. In accordance with legal documents, confiscation is a measure of punishment that can be implemented in special cases. All of them are specified in the legislation. So, for example, money can be confiscated from a person who used them to carry out criminal activities. Such an event does not require judicial confirmation. It is carried out by decision of an official who is on duty in law enforcement agencies. Citizens should be aware that all other seizures without a court order are illegal. They should be appealed accordingly. This is also described in the legislation. Understanding the order of alienation allows to react in time to unlawful decisions of officials. For example, confiscation of goods can be carried out in accordance with the decision of the court. That is, law enforcement officials should demand the appropriate document. Without its presentation, the event is considered illegal.

When confiscation is applied

Often, the alienation of property is connected with crimes or other violations of the law. Confiscation (withdrawal) is carried out if it is proved that money or objects are received in violation of the law. This does not apply to all the property of a person. There are exceptions, which we'll talk about later. Money and things are subject to withdrawal if their turnover violates the law. In addition, alienate (take away) the items that participated in the crimes. For example, weapons that attempted to kill. Money is withdrawn much more often. The means to be confiscated include:

  • Obtained through criminal means;
  • Illegally crossed the border;
  • Due to the sale of stolen property;
  • Those with which the terrorist activities were carried out.

The above cases of withdrawal of money or items require a judicial decision.

Procedure

Confiscation of goods and other property is carried out in accordance with a certain procedure. Violation of this order is illegal. The procedure consists of the following actions:

  • The case is sent to the judicial authority and it is considered.
  • If there are grounds, a decision is made to confiscate the property.
  • An execution sheet is issued - a document confirming the rights of the official body for further action.
  • The property specified in the paper is seized. This means that it can not be sold or mortgaged.
  • The property specified in the court decision is transferred to the state body. The latter must put it on balance. He does not have the right to refuse.

With regard to money, another procedure is being carried out. The executive sheet arrives at the bank, it indicates the account for their transfer and the deadline for completion.

Protection of family members

Spouses, as a rule, conduct a joint farm. But this does not mean that the wife is responsible for the decision to confiscate her husband's property, for example. The only thing that can be taken away is that which belongs to the person indicated in the writ of execution. The remaining members of the seven are given the right to prove that they are the owners of this or that thing. For this you need to provide documents. These include sales contracts, checks and other securities in which the name of the property owner is indicated. If there are no documents, then it is permissible to turn to witness testimony.

What can not be confiscated

The law prescribes a list of property that can not be taken from a person, no matter what crime he committed. Such subjects include:

  • The only place of residence.
  • The land on which the house stands. Only if the family has no other housing.
  • Land used as a source of income, livestock, poultry and other. But only when there is no other means for existence.
  • Personal things necessary for the life of the person and his family.
  • Fuel used to heat the home.
  • Money in the amount of the subsistence minimum.
  • Social payments, including maternity capital.

Lawyers recommend that you keep receipts for the purchase of property in order to protect yourself in the event that one of the members of the family applies confiscation. This foresight allows you to protect your rights.

Illegal confiscation

There are mistakes in judicial proceedings. So, sometimes unreasonable decisions are made, which provide for the confiscation of property. The Russian Federation legislatively enshrined the right of citizens to return what they were wrongly deprived of. In practice, it is not always possible to get property back. Then compensation is paid for it. The decision on it is made by the relevant executive authority. It is considered final and not subject to change. Disputes on these issues are resolved in court.

It should be remembered that the nationalized property is not refundable, a certain amount of money is paid for it. There are still a number of cases when it is impossible to return one. For example, if the property is destroyed due to a cataclysm, then you should not try to get it back into property.
